目录结构
源码目录
aiproxy-new/
├── admin-api/ # PHP 管理后台 API
│ ├── app/
│ │ ├── Controller/ # 控制器
│ │ ├── Service/ # 业务逻辑
│ │ ├── Library/ # 工具库(HttpClient等)
│ │ ├── Middleware/ # 中间件(Auth/Admin)
│ │ └── Config.php # 配置文件
│ ├── route/
│ │ └── api.php # 路由表
│ ├── command/ # CLI 脚本(sync-usage等)
│ └── public/
│ └── index.php # 入口文件
├── admin-ui/ # Vben Admin 前端
│ └── apps/
│ └── web-antd/ # Ant Design Vue 版本
├── openresty/ # OpenResty Lua 源码
│ └── lua/
│ ├── admin.lua # 管理接口路由
│ ├── admin/ # 管理模块
│ │ ├── config.lua # 配置推送
│ │ ├── balance.lua # 余额同步
│ │ ├── usage.lua # 用量拉取
│ │ ├── nginx.lua # Nginx 管理
│ │ ├── stats.lua # 内存表统计
│ │ ├── dict.lua # 内存表 KV 查看
│ │ ├── health.lua # 健康检查
│ │ └── debug.lua # 调试接口
│ ├── handler/ # 数据面 handler
│ │ ├── chat.lua # 对话补全
│ │ ├── embeddings.lua # 向量嵌入
│ │ └── models.lua # 模型列表
│ ├── lib/ # 公共库
│ │ └── signer.lua # HMAC 签名
│ ├── storage/ # 存储模块
│ └── init.lua # 数据面路由入口
├── site/ # VitePress 文档站点
│ └── src/
│ ├── index.md # 首页
│ ├── guide/ # 用户指南
│ ├── admin/ # 管理后台
│ ├── api/ # API 参考
│ ├── deploy/ # 部署运维
│ └── architecture/ # 架构设计
└── docs/ # 旧版 VitePress 文档部署目录
dist-new/
├── site/ # 文档站点(VitePress 构建产物)
├── admin-ui/ # 管理后台(Vben Admin 构建产物)
├── admin-api/ # PHP 管理 API
│ ├── public/index.php # 入口
│ ├── app/ # 应用代码
│ └── route/ # 路由
└── proxy-api/ # OpenResty Lua 脚本
└── lua/
├── admin.lua
├── admin/
├── handler/
├── lib/
├── storage/
└── init.lua